CityNote Hotel
3-star hotel near Beijing Road Pedestrian Street, connected to a shopping center
There's a restaurant on site. Free breakfast is served daily. WiFi is free in public spaces. CityNote Hotel also features a fitness center, coffee/tea in a common area, and concierge services.
Smoking is allowed in designated areas at this 3-star Guangzhou hotel.

CityNote Hotel offers 47 accommodations with safes and slippers. Televisions come with cable channels. Bathrooms include showers, hair dryers, and children's slippers.
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wireless Internet access (speed: 100+ Mbps (good for 1–2 people or up to 6 devices)). Business-friendly amenities include printers and phones. Housekeeping is offered daily and irons/ironing boards can be requested.

Close to Peking road shopping district. Easy to get in and out of cab. Friendly and helpful host at the check-in. However the AC did not operate properly when we requested for assistance, one lady inspected but with rude comments like being our fault. That’s the major turn down, otherwise, everything was great and breakfast was also exceeded expectations.
The cleaning lady was very nice. I was only going to be there for 4 nights and so I hung the "Do not disturb" sign up (I'm not one of those tourists who expects my bed made every day - I can keep things tidy myself), but she still kindly left two bottles of water for me every morning and that helped - I am so grateful for her kindness.
Also, the breakfasts were very nice. It was buffet style and the food choices were very good.
Now for the negative stuff - it's like a minimum-security prison there. You need to use your e-card constantly to get through various doors. One morning the doors leading to the elevator were locked and the button to push to open them did not work. I walked to the 4th floor from the 5th and took the elevator to the lobby, but it was frustrating trying to convey this problem to the guy at the front desk. Even with a translator he kept offering to reactivate my e-card but that wasn't the problem.
I just wanted him to know there was zero reason to lock people out of gaining access to elevators. On WeChat staff sent me excuses, but I didn't see why they needed to lock those doors when the button would not work.
Why so much security? This is China, things are pretty safe. The hotel seems to be a part of a larger building - 19 floors (?) - so maybe they want to keep those people out of the hotel?
Then my last night the air conditioning stopped working. There are NO WINDOWS to open in a standard room. It became suffocatingly hot in there.
